Understanding Window Glazing
Window glazing refers to using a transparent or translucent movie or layer to windows to enhance performance and appearance. Glazing can vary based upon aspects such as thickness, kind of glass, and the specific needs of a structure. The main objective of window glazing is to enable natural light to get in while supplying a barrier versus environmental components.
Types of Window Glazing
There are several kinds of window glazing near me choices offered, including:
Single Glazing: This is the simplest form of glazing, consisting of a single pane of glass. Although cost-efficient, it uses minimal insulation and might result in greater energy costs.
Double Glazing: This involves two panes of glass separated by a space (typically filled with argon gas) that offers excellent thermal insulation. Double-glazed windows can substantially decrease heat loss and noise invasion.
Triple Glazing: Similar to double glazing however with three panes of glass. It uses improved insulation and soundproofing however at a greater cost and weight.
Low-E Glass: Low-emissivity (Low-E) glass is treated with a special covering that shows heat and lessens UV light transmission. This kind of glazing can assist keep interiors c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ter season.
Tempered Glass: This is glass that has actually been treated to increase its strength. It is frequently used in areas requiring security, as it shatters into little, blunt pieces rather than sharp shards.
Laminated Glass: This consists of two or more layers of glass bonded together by a plastic interlayer. It is frequently utilized for its soundproofing and safety features.
Benefits of Professional Window Glazing Services
Investing in professional window glazing services uses various advantages:
Energy Efficiency: Proper glazing lessens heat transfer, which can result in lower heating & cooling bills.
Increased Comfort: Good glazing helps preserve a steady indoor temperature level, guaranteeing convenience for homeowners or workers.
Enhanced Aesthetics: Professional glazing provides a refined appearance that can significantly enhance the property's curb appeal.
Noise Reduction: Quality glazing offers much better noise insulation, perfect for properties located near hectic streets or noisy environments.
Security and Security: Double and triple glazing, as well as laminated glass, offer extra defense against burglaries and unexpected glass breakage.
UV Protection: Certain glazing options, like Low-E glass, can safeguard home furnishings from damage triggered by UV rays, extending their lifespan.

Common Window Glazing Techniques
Various methods may be utilized during the glazing procedure, such as:
Bead Glazing: Involves a bead (or seal) to hold the glass in location, supplying a watertight seal.
Captive Glazing: The glass is held in location by a frame that substantially decreases air leaks.
Pocket Glazing: The glass fits into a pocket or groove and is sealed with putty or silicone.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)What is the difference between single, double, and triple glazing?
Single glazing consists of one pane of glass, double glazing has 2 panes with a space for insulation, and triple glazing consists of three panes for optimum energy efficiency.
How does window glazing improve energy efficiency?
Window glazing minimizes heat transfer, lowering the requirement for artificial cooling and heating, which results in lower energy consumption and costs.
Is window glazing worth the financial investment?
Yes, buying professional window glazing uses significant long-term cost savings on energy costs and enhances the convenience and security of your property.
How do I maintain my glazed windows?
Routinely check for any damage, tidy the glass with an appropriate cleaner, and guarantee that seals are undamaged to keep performance.
